The official Mbed 2 C/C++ SDK provides the software platform and libraries to build your applications.

Dependents:   hello SerialTestv11 SerialTestv12 Sierpinski ... more

mbed 2

This is the mbed 2 library. If you'd like to learn about Mbed OS please see the mbed-os docs.

Committer:
AnnaBridge
Date:
Thu Nov 08 11:45:42 2018 +0000
Revision:
171:3a7713b1edbc
Parent:
TARGET_RZ_A1H/TARGET_RENESAS/TARGET_RZ_A1XX/TARGET_RZ_A1H/device/inc/iobitmasks/ostm_iobitmask.h@161:aa5281ff4a02
mbed library. Release version 164

Who changed what in which revision?

UserRevisionLine numberNew contents of line
AnnaBridge 161:aa5281ff4a02 1 /*******************************************************************************
AnnaBridge 161:aa5281ff4a02 2 * DISCLAIMER
AnnaBridge 161:aa5281ff4a02 3 * This software is supplied by Renesas Electronics Corporation and is only
AnnaBridge 161:aa5281ff4a02 4 * intended for use with Renesas products. No other uses are authorized. This
AnnaBridge 161:aa5281ff4a02 5 * software is owned by Renesas Electronics Corporation and is protected under
AnnaBridge 161:aa5281ff4a02 6 * all applicable laws, including copyright laws.
AnnaBridge 161:aa5281ff4a02 7 * THIS SOFTWARE IS PROVIDED "AS IS" AND RENESAS MAKES NO WARRANTIES REGARDING
AnnaBridge 161:aa5281ff4a02 8 * THIS SOFTWARE, WHETHER EXPRESS, IMPLIED OR STATUTORY, INCLUDING BUT NOT
AnnaBridge 161:aa5281ff4a02 9 * LIMITED TO W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E
AnnaBridge 161:aa5281ff4a02 10 * AND NON-INFRINGEMENT. ALL SUCH WARRANTIES ARE EXPRESSLY DISCLAIMED.
AnnaBridge 161:aa5281ff4a02 11 * TO THE MAXIMUM EXTENT PERMITTED NOT PROHIBITED BY LAW, NEITHER RENESAS
AnnaBridge 161:aa5281ff4a02 12 * ELECTRONICS CORPORATION NOR ANY OF ITS AFFILIATED COMPANIES SHALL BE LIABLE
AnnaBridge 161:aa5281ff4a02 13 * FOR ANY DIRECT, INDIRECT, SPECIAL, INCIDENTAL OR CONSEQUENTIAL DAMAGES FOR
AnnaBridge 161:aa5281ff4a02 14 * ANY REASON RELATED TO THIS SOFTWARE, EVEN IF RENESAS OR ITS AFFILIATES HAVE
AnnaBridge 161:aa5281ff4a02 15 * B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ES.
AnnaBridge 161:aa5281ff4a02 16 * Renesas reserves the right, without notice, to make changes to this software
AnnaBridge 161:aa5281ff4a02 17 * and to discontinue the availability of this software. By using this software,
AnnaBridge 161:aa5281ff4a02 18 * you agree to the additional terms and conditions found by accessing the
AnnaBridge 161:aa5281ff4a02 19 * following link:
AnnaBridge 161:aa5281ff4a02 20 * http://www.renesas.com/disclaimer
AnnaBridge 161:aa5281ff4a02 21 * Copyright (C) 2012 - 2014 Renesas Electronics Corporation. All rights reserved.
AnnaBridge 161:aa5281ff4a02 22 *******************************************************************************/
AnnaBridge 161:aa5281ff4a02 23 /*******************************************************************************
AnnaBridge 161:aa5281ff4a02 24 * File Name : ostm_iobitmask.h
AnnaBridge 161:aa5281ff4a02 25 * $Rev: 1115 $
AnnaBridge 161:aa5281ff4a02 26 * $Date:: 2014-07-09 15:35:02 +0900#$
AnnaBridge 161:aa5281ff4a02 27 * Description : OSTM register define header
AnnaBridge 161:aa5281ff4a02 28 *******************************************************************************/
AnnaBridge 161:aa5281ff4a02 29 #ifndef OSTM_IOBITMASK_H
AnnaBridge 161:aa5281ff4a02 30 #define OSTM_IOBITMASK_H
AnnaBridge 161:aa5281ff4a02 31
AnnaBridge 161:aa5281ff4a02 32
AnnaBridge 161:aa5281ff4a02 33 /* ==== Mask values for IO registers ==== */
AnnaBridge 161:aa5281ff4a02 34 /* ---- OSTM0 ---- */
AnnaBridge 161:aa5281ff4a02 35 #define OSTM0_OSTMnCMP_OSTMnCMP (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 36
AnnaBridge 161:aa5281ff4a02 37 #define OSTM0_OSTMnCNT_OSTMnCNT (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 38
AnnaBridge 161:aa5281ff4a02 39 #define OSTM0_OSTMnTE_OSTMnTE (0x01u)
AnnaBridge 161:aa5281ff4a02 40
AnnaBridge 161:aa5281ff4a02 41 #define OSTM0_OSTMnTS_OSTMnTS (0x01u)
AnnaBridge 161:aa5281ff4a02 42
AnnaBridge 161:aa5281ff4a02 43 #define OSTM0_OSTMnTT_OSTMnTT (0x01u)
AnnaBridge 161:aa5281ff4a02 44
AnnaBridge 161:aa5281ff4a02 45 #define OSTM0_OSTMnCTL_MD0 (0x00000001uL)
AnnaBridge 161:aa5281ff4a02 46 #define OSTM0_OSTMnCTL_MD1 (0x00000002uL)
AnnaBridge 161:aa5281ff4a02 47
AnnaBridge 161:aa5281ff4a02 48 /* ---- OSTM1 ---- */
AnnaBridge 161:aa5281ff4a02 49 #define OSTM1_OSTMnCMP_OSTMnCMP (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 50
AnnaBridge 161:aa5281ff4a02 51 #define OSTM1_OSTMnCNT_OSTMnCNT (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 52
AnnaBridge 161:aa5281ff4a02 53 #define OSTM1_OSTMnTE_OSTMnTE (0x01u)
AnnaBridge 161:aa5281ff4a02 54
AnnaBridge 161:aa5281ff4a02 55 #define OSTM1_OSTMnTS_OSTMnTS (0x01u)
AnnaBridge 161:aa5281ff4a02 56
AnnaBridge 161:aa5281ff4a02 57 #define OSTM1_OSTMnTT_OSTMnTT (0x01u)
AnnaBridge 161:aa5281ff4a02 58
AnnaBridge 161:aa5281ff4a02 59 #define OSTM1_OSTMnCTL_MD0 (0x00000001uL)
AnnaBridge 161:aa5281ff4a02 60 #define OSTM1_OSTMnCTL_MD1 (0x00000002uL)
AnnaBridge 161:aa5281ff4a02 61
AnnaBridge 161:aa5281ff4a02 62 /* ---- OSTMn ---- */
AnnaBridge 161:aa5281ff4a02 63 #define OSTMn_OSTMnCMP_OSTMnCMP (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 64
AnnaBridge 161:aa5281ff4a02 65 #define OSTMn_OSTMnCNT_OSTMnCNT (0xFFFFFFFFuL)
AnnaBridge 161:aa5281ff4a02 66
AnnaBridge 161:aa5281ff4a02 67 #define OSTMn_OSTMnTE_OSTMnTE (0x01u)
AnnaBridge 161:aa5281ff4a02 68
AnnaBridge 161:aa5281ff4a02 69 #define OSTMn_OSTMnTS_OSTMnTS (0x01u)
AnnaBridge 161:aa5281ff4a02 70
AnnaBridge 161:aa5281ff4a02 71 #define OSTMn_OSTMnTT_OSTMnTT (0x01u)
AnnaBridge 161:aa5281ff4a02 72
AnnaBridge 161:aa5281ff4a02 73 #define OSTMn_OSTMnCTL_MD0 (0x00000001uL)
AnnaBridge 161:aa5281ff4a02 74 #define OSTMn_OSTMnCTL_MD1 (0x00000002uL)
AnnaBridge 161:aa5281ff4a02 75
AnnaBridge 161:aa5281ff4a02 76
AnnaBridge 161:aa5281ff4a02 77 /* ==== Shift values for IO registers ==== */
AnnaBridge 161:aa5281ff4a02 78 /* ---- OSTM0 ---- */
AnnaBridge 161:aa5281ff4a02 79 #define OSTM0_OSTMnCMP_OSTMnCMP_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 80
AnnaBridge 161:aa5281ff4a02 81 #define OSTM0_OSTMnCNT_OSTMnCNT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 82
AnnaBridge 161:aa5281ff4a02 83 #define OSTM0_OSTMnTE_OSTMnTE_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 84
AnnaBridge 161:aa5281ff4a02 85 #define OSTM0_OSTMnTS_OSTMnTS_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 86
AnnaBridge 161:aa5281ff4a02 87 #define OSTM0_OSTMnTT_OSTMnTT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 88
AnnaBridge 161:aa5281ff4a02 89 #define OSTM0_OSTMnCTL_MD0_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 90 #define OSTM0_OSTMnCTL_MD1_SHIFT (1u)
AnnaBridge 161:aa5281ff4a02 91
AnnaBridge 161:aa5281ff4a02 92 /* ---- OSTM1 ---- */
AnnaBridge 161:aa5281ff4a02 93 #define OSTM1_OSTMnCMP_OSTMnCMP_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 94
AnnaBridge 161:aa5281ff4a02 95 #define OSTM1_OSTMnCNT_OSTMnCNT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 96
AnnaBridge 161:aa5281ff4a02 97 #define OSTM1_OSTMnTE_OSTMnTE_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 98
AnnaBridge 161:aa5281ff4a02 99 #define OSTM1_OSTMnTS_OSTMnTS_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 100
AnnaBridge 161:aa5281ff4a02 101 #define OSTM1_OSTMnTT_OSTMnTT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 102
AnnaBridge 161:aa5281ff4a02 103 #define OSTM1_OSTMnCTL_MD0_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 104 #define OSTM1_OSTMnCTL_MD1_SHIFT (1u)
AnnaBridge 161:aa5281ff4a02 105
AnnaBridge 161:aa5281ff4a02 106 /* ---- OSTMn ---- */
AnnaBridge 161:aa5281ff4a02 107 #define OSTMn_OSTMnCMP_OSTMnCMP_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 108
AnnaBridge 161:aa5281ff4a02 109 #define OSTMn_OSTMnCNT_OSTMnCNT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 110
AnnaBridge 161:aa5281ff4a02 111 #define OSTMn_OSTMnTE_OSTMnTE_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 112
AnnaBridge 161:aa5281ff4a02 113 #define OSTMn_OSTMnTS_OSTMnTS_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 114
AnnaBridge 161:aa5281ff4a02 115 #define OSTMn_OSTMnTT_OSTMnTT_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 116
AnnaBridge 161:aa5281ff4a02 117 #define OSTMn_OSTMnCTL_MD0_SHIFT (0u)
AnnaBridge 161:aa5281ff4a02 118 #define OSTMn_OSTMnCTL_MD1_SHIFT (1u)
AnnaBridge 161:aa5281ff4a02 119
AnnaBridge 161:aa5281ff4a02 120
AnnaBridge 161:aa5281ff4a02 121 #endif /* OSTM_IOBITMASK_H */
AnnaBridge 161:aa5281ff4a02 122
AnnaBridge 161:aa5281ff4a02 123 /* End of File */